Article summary:

1. This paper proposes a modified inertial three-term conjugate gradient projection method for solving nonlinear monotone equations with convex constraints.

2. The proposed algorithm combines the ideas of the modified spectral gradient projection method, the hybrid three-term conjugate gradient projection method, and the inertial extrapolation step strategy.

3. Under standard conditions, it is proven that the proposed algorithm has global convergence and linear convergence rate.
